Mathnasium of Yorba Linda's personalized geometry tutoring programs are designed to support students at every stage of their math journey.
We help students master foundational topics such as angles, shapes, congruence, and measurement, improving their spatial reasoning and logical thinking so they’re well prepared to take on more advanced geometry with confidence.
Using personalized learning plans, we can guide students through high-school-level geometric concepts such as proofs, triangles, circles, transformations, and the Pythagorean theorem. We focus on helping them truly understand how geometry works.
At Mathnasium, advanced learners and students preparing for math competitions can tackle rigorous proofs, coordinate geometry, and multi-step challenges, deepening their understanding and strengthening skills for college-level coursework.
At Mathnasium of Yorba Linda, our specially trained tutors work with students of all skill levels to help them truly understand and enjoy geometry through face-to-face instruction in a fun and empowering environment.
We guide students to connect geometric concepts to logical reasoning and real-world applications. As their understanding grows, so does their confidence to approach new problems with clarity and precision.
We employ the Mathnasium Method™, a proprietary teaching approach that combines personalized learning plans with proven instructional techniques. We work with students both in-center and online, helping them develop a lasting understanding of geometry.
In each session, students receive face-to-face instruction in a small-group setting where they strengthen problem-solving skills and deepen their understanding of geometric relationships and logic.
Students begin their Mathnasium enrollment with a diagnostic assessment that helps us pinpoint their current skill level, knowledge gaps, and learning goals.
Using these insights, we develop a personalized learning plan tailored to each student’s needs. Our tutors then target instruction on key topics such as angles, congruence, transformations, the Pythagorean Theorem, and proofs, ensuring they learn and master each concept step by step.

We help students learn and master K–12 geometry topics like:
Angles, triangles, and plane figures
Circles and polygons
Transformations: reflections, rotations, translations, and dilations
Coordinate geometry: distance, midpoint, slope
Congruence and similarity
Volume and surface area of 3D shapes
Logic, reasoning, and writing proofs
These topics can be built into the student's personalized learning plan based on their unique needs and goals.
